| Introduction | This course surveys a wide array of literature written by women throughout time and geographical locations, while remaining attentive to the situational contexts which inflect these works. In this way, we will resist coming to any "universal" or "essential" truths about all women and gender more broadly. Instead, this course is designed to show the rich diversity among women authors in their approaches to the themes of our course : exile, alienation, community, articulations of feminism, and the body as object and subject. We will also come to terms with the role of women within the entire print market cycle, as editors, authors, and readers. We will also push the edges of what is literature and fiction by reading pulp and self-help books directed at a mainly female audience. |
